Hard to say if the cool kids will be attracted to a band they can't understand, but Icelandic band Sigur Ros has stayed popular and with Malajube's growing popularity, other French-Canadian exports are getting another look or two. Les Breastfeeders' most recent album came out last August and is titled Les Matins de Grands Soirs. It's guitar heavy garage rock full of shout-heavy choruses. It's high energy, catchy (even if sung in French) and loads of fun. The songs are as strong and boisterous in French as they would be in English, so the language doesn't really matter much to me...it's just good.
